Across TCGA patient cohorts, TJP2 mutation is significantly associated with the RNA expression of many other genes, with 3,218 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ible TJP2-associated genes across cancer lineages are NDUFA6, HUNK, and UQCR11. Each is linked with TJP2 in more than 3 cancer types. Because this analysis shows association rather than direction, both TJP2-to-partner and partner-to-TJP2 results are reported.
